JOB DESCRIPTION Job Title: Post No: Department: Location: Grade: Salary: Hours: GO Wales (AtWE) Project Opportunities Assistant ND015XX Employability Careers Service Cyncoed/Llandaff as required 4 A/B 23,879 28,452 per annum Full Time 37hrs per week Tenure: Fixed term until 31 st March 2019 Accountable to: GO Wales Project Coordinator Role Summary: To provide support to Cardiff Met s GO Wales Achieve through Work Experience project Team in their work with students under the age of 25 requiring higher levels of employability support. To be the first point of contact for students referred to the project as potential participants and to guide them through the application process. To coordinate and administer the process of participant Employability Assessment using the project s dedicated assessment tool. To support Project Advisers in referral of students to appropriate internal or external departments.

To be the first point of contact for employers who contact the GO Wales team to express an interest in hosting student work experience and to work in conjunction with Project Advisers to convert expressions of interest into engagement with the project. Principal Duties and Responsibilities: 1. To deal with incoming enquiries to the GO Wales project office by email, phone and in person, responding or referring on as appropriate. 2. To liaise with individual students to establish basic eligibility and coordinate the production of required documentary evidence. 3. To facilitate individual students undertaking the Achieve through Work Experience Employability Assessment using the dedicated online assessment tool ensuring that, after assessment, the associated sections of the GO Wales online database are fully completed. 4. To report to Project Advisers regarding individual student assessment results to enable Advisers to make a final decision on acceptance onto the project. 5. To administer the re-assessment of students progress against the Employability Assessment measure after each work experience intervention. 6. To maintain regular contact with participants throughout their period on the project. 7. To Monitor progress of a varied and complex group of student participants, using hard-copy records, the GO Wales online database and CareerHub to produce regular reports and analysis for the GO Wales Project Coordinator which will inform development of both short-term project initiatives and the strategic direction of the project at Cardiff Met. 8. To provide support for the processing of employer placement subsidy and participant expenses claims. 9. To discuss with candidates, via email or face-to-face meetings, their preferences for type of taster, duration/timing any special arrangements etc. 10. To work with candidates and employers to ensure all relevant paperwork is completed to the necessary standard and within agreed timescales, ensuring that participant records and admin systems are kept up-to-date and accurate using the appropriate systems and financial procedures required by Cardiff Metropolitan University and HEFCW.

11. To support students with CVs, covering letters and application forms in line with agreed standards. 12. To enter details of Work Tasters and placement opportunities to Career Hub in line with agreed policies. 13. To maintain knowledge of relevant opportunities in Career Hub in order to support students to identify appropriate opportunities. 14. To prepare regular written reports for GO Wales Project Advisers on the latest participant registrations. 15. To ensure that work tasters and placement opportunities are shared with student participants through social media channels. 16. Using Career Hub, maintain a database of registered participants and potential work experience opportunities to facilitate matching for tailored work experience outcomes. 17. To support employer events as directed by the GO Wales Project Coordinator. 18. To undertake research into potential employer hosts and conduct initial discussion by phone, email or face-to-face meetings with employers with a view to securing new Work Experience opportunities, reporting on them appropriately to the GO Wales Project Coordinator. 19. To build relationships with employers. From the initial approach and going out to employers to identify opportunities, through to evaluating their experience of working with the GO Wales Achieve through Work Experience project. 20. To develop and maintain own knowledge of local, regional and national labour markets. 21. To regularly review processes and make recommendations for improvement. 22. To support students, university staff, and career service colleagues to use Career Hub by acting as first point of contact for technical enquiries. 23. To participate in the development and delivery of generic skills workshops including CV-writing, application forms and job-searching techniques. 24. To identify any online resources which would be useful to students to develop their employability and signpost them accordingly.

25. To undertake project work on a regular basis as directed by the GO Wales Project Coordinator. 26. To undertake relevant professional development opportunities as agreed with line manager. 27. To work in line with the behavioural framework agreed for the Careers Service. 28. To Supervise and oversee the training of Junior and/or Casual Administrative project support staff employed during periods of high activity requiring additional support. 29. Any other relevant duties commensurate with the grade of the post. Additional Information: This post is funded under the GO Wales programme, which is managed by the Higher Education Funding Council for Wales and sponsored by the Welsh Assembly Government with additional funding from the European Social Fund.
